About Daniel B. Vigneron

Daniel B. Vigneron is a scholar working on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Spectroscopy,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Materials Chemistry and Biophysics, having authored 387 papers that have together received 25.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ced MRI Techniques and Applications (221 papers), Advanced NMR Techniques and Applications (202 papers), Atomic and Subatomic Physics Research (64 papers), Electron Spin Resonance Studies (49 papers), MRI in cancer diagnosis (40 papers), Medical Imaging Techniques and Applications (35 papers), Advanced Neuroimaging Techniques and Applications (33 papers) and NMR spectroscopy and applications (30 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(13.0k citations), Spectroscopy (7.4k citations), Biophysics (2.6k citations),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health (3.6k citations) and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(4.6k citations). Daniel B. Vigneron has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Canada and Denmark. Frequent co-authors include John Kurhanewicz, Sarah J. Nelson, A. James Barkovich, Donna M. Ferriero, Robert Bok, Peder E. Z. Larson, Duan Xu, Steven P. Miller, Sarah J. Nelson and Peter R. Carroll. Their work appears in journals such as Magnetic Resonance in Medicine, Journal of Magnetic Resonance Imaging, Magnetic Resonance Imaging, Journal of Magnetic Resonance and American Journal of Neuroradiology.
